Mystery Train
"How do you solve a mystery when everyone is a suspect? It's 1893, and some of the world's brightest minds are traveling by train to the World's Fair in Chicago. But after a dastardly crime puts the fate of the Fair in peril, only you can piece together the clues and collar the criminal. All aboard for a whodunit that will keep you guessing until the last twist of the tracks!"
You will receive a Train Ticket from Edison. Hurrah! Board the train and find Edison!
Go left. Click the guy in the first cart. Click on the last speech bubble, and he will give you a telegram. Go left. Enter S.B. Anthony's room and talk to the lady. She will give you a Women's Suffrage Pamphlet. Now exit the room. Go left, until you reach Mark Twain's room. From there, go a bit more left and grab the pencil on the table. |
Keep going left, passing by the porter. He/She somehow looks similar to you (foreshadow!). Now that you have talked to everyone else, go back and talk to Edison. This is when a long cutscene, as well as when your case, begins!
YOU'RE ON THE CASE!
Talk to the NY Times Reporter. He will give you a clue.
Proceed to Mark Twain's cabin, which is right beside Edison's cabin. Go right until you reach a door that says "Mark Twain". Enter it. Talk to Mark Twain, and he will be a bit nervous. You will have to test the wall for a secret compartment. It is the 3rd one on the 2nd row. |
Oops! It was just a book! But something happened! The train suddenly stopped! Click on the guy below you, and the train will start moving again. Now go left, and enter Susan B. Anthony's room. Talk to her. She will give you a new clue.
Go back to the first cart and talk to the coal man. Ask him what he was doing around the passenger's luggage.
He's only getting a snack? Now go left until you reach the porter. Talk to him.
On your way, stop in front of Edison's door. Prune juice stains on the floor! Examine it.
Talk to the porter. So the coal man did get a snack! That got rid of that clue. Now ask about the prune juice. He says the orders are confidential. He rips out a page and it flies away. You will automatically collect the porter's notebook. Click on the notebook, and you will ask yourself if you could find the imprints. Use your pen from earlier. Colour the middle part of the sheet and this is what you should get: |
Go right, into the luggage area. There you will see the Mademoiselle. She will tell you to dress like the porter since you look like him/her (foreshadow!) to enter Tesla's room and "give him a drink". Now enter the porter room and click on the clothes to change into the Porter Outfit! (TIP: You MUST put on the whole outfit or else it won't work.)
Go right and click on Tesla's door. Now you can enter and talk to him. Click on the prune juice on the table beside the door and give it to him. He needs to go to the bathroom. Now you can search his stuff!
